When is Power Book 4 Season 2 coming out?
According to Starz, the Power Book 4 Season 2 release date is set for Friday, September 1, 2023. The show will return to the Starz app, as well as all Starz streaming channels. It will also reach in-demand platforms and internationally on the premium streaming platform Lionsgate+.
For those who are Starz subscribers in the United States and Canada, the second season will air at 8 p.m. ET.

Power Book IV: Force is the third in an expanded series based on the 2014 crime drama Power, which was created and produced by Courtney A. Kemp in collaboration with Curtis “50 Cent” Jackson. The series stars Joseph Sikora, Isaac Keys, Lili Simmons, Shane Harper, Kris D. Lofton, Carmela Zumbado, Manuel Eduardo Ramirez, and Miriam A. Hyman, among others.
“After cutting ties in New York, Tommy Egan’s new family and his ruthless drug game prompted him to stay in Chicago,” reads the official synopsis for the new season. “The explosive second season begins with Tommy on a mission to avenge the death of Lilliana, his former nemesis turned business partner. With Diamond (Isaac Keys) and Jenard (Kris D. Lofton) at odds, the weakened Flynn organization, and a new connection. on the scene, Tommy is more determined than ever to take over Chicago’s drug world.
